Tuesday May 9, 2001 Bergkamp proves Final fitness from soccernet.com 'All I felt was a little tired, the normal tiredness you feel after a game,' said Bergkamp. 'I had been out five weeks and, although I have been able to train normally and hard for the last ten days, it is good to have match fitness. The idea was to play for an hour but I could have carried on for longer without a problem. 'The manager watched me and he knows I am fit. I hope to be included. I missed out in 1998 because of injury and you think then that you won't get another chance. But here it is and, hopefully, I will be involved.' Bergkamp also made it clear that, if given his his chance when Wenger names his starting line-up, he will not be overawed by the occasion. 'No, I love these games,' he said. 'Maybe it is something to do with growing up in Holland where there are not many big games. But in big games, I think I have proved in the past that I love them with the way I have played.' |
